    Chin liposuction in Toronto is a popular procedure designed to enhance facial contours by removing excess fat from the chin area. The duration of the procedure can vary depending on several factors, including the amount of fat to be removed, the technique used, and the individual's specific needs. Generally, chin liposuction can be completed within 1 to 2 hours.

    Pre-operative consultations are crucial to determine the exact duration and plan the procedure. During this consultation, a qualified plastic surgeon will assess the patient's facial structure, discuss their aesthetic goals, and outline the expected timeline for the surgery.

    Post-operative recovery time also varies. Most patients can return to their normal activities within a few days to a week, although complete recovery may take several weeks. It's important to follow the surgeon's post-operative care instructions to ensure optimal results and a smooth recovery process.

    In summary, while the actual chin liposuction procedure in Toronto typically lasts between 1 to 2 hours, the overall process, including consultations and recovery, requires careful planning and adherence to medical guidelines.

    Understanding the Duration of Chin Liposuction in Toronto

    Chin liposuction is a popular procedure in Toronto designed to enhance facial contours by removing excess fat from the chin area. The duration of this surgery can vary, but it generally falls within the range of 1 to 2 hours. This timeframe is influenced by several factors, including the amount of fat to be removed and the specific techniques employed by the surgeon.

    Factors Affecting Surgery Duration

    Several elements can influence the length of chin liposuction surgery:

    1. Amount of Fat: The more fat that needs to be removed, the longer the procedure will take. Surgeons carefully assess the fat deposits to determine the appropriate amount to be extracted for optimal results.

    2. Technique Used: Different techniques, such as tumescent liposuction or laser-assisted liposuction, can affect the duration. Each method has its own procedural steps and recovery times.

    3. Patient's Anatomy: Every patient's facial structure is unique. Some may have more fibrous tissue or denser fat, which can slightly extend the surgery time.

    Pre-Surgery Preparation

    Before the procedure, a thorough consultation with the surgeon is essential. During this consultation, the surgeon will evaluate the patient's medical history, current health status, and aesthetic goals. This helps in customizing the procedure to meet individual needs and expectations.

    The Surgical Process

    The actual surgery involves several steps:

    1. Anesthesia: Local anesthesia with sedation is commonly used to ensure patient comfort during the procedure.

    2. Incision: Small incisions are made in inconspicuous areas to access the fat deposits.

    3. Fat Removal: Using specialized instruments, the surgeon carefully removes the fat. The technique used will depend on the surgeon's preference and the patient's specific needs.

    4. Contouring: After fat removal, the surgeon contours the chin area to achieve a natural and aesthetically pleasing result.

    Post-Surgery Recovery

    Recovery time varies but generally, patients can return to normal activities within a few days. Swelling and bruising are common initially but typically subside within a couple of weeks. It's important to follow the surgeon's post-operative instructions to ensure proper healing and optimal results.

    Understanding the Duration of Chin Liposuction in Toronto

    Chin liposuction is a popular procedure designed to enhance the contour of the chin and jawline by removing excess fat. If you're considering this procedure in Toronto, understanding the duration of the treatment is crucial for planning and expectations. Here’s a detailed overview to help you grasp what to expect.

    Initial Consultation and Preparation

    Before the actual procedure, a thorough consultation with your surgeon is essential. This meeting typically lasts about an hour, during which your surgeon will evaluate your medical history, discuss your aesthetic goals, and determine the best approach for your chin liposuction. Pre-operative instructions, including fasting and avoiding certain medications, will also be provided.

    The Procedure Itself

    The duration of the chin liposuction procedure itself can vary based on individual factors such as the amount of fat to be removed and the specific techniques used. Generally, the procedure takes between 1 to 2 hours. During this time, local anesthesia is administered to ensure your comfort. The surgeon will make small incisions under the chin and use a thin cannula to suction out the fat. The process is meticulous to ensure precise results and minimal scarring.

    Post-Operative Recovery

    Following the procedure, you will need some time to recover. Most patients can return to their normal activities within a few days, though strenuous activities should be avoided for about two weeks. Swelling and bruising are common and can last for up to two weeks. Your surgeon will provide detailed post-operative care instructions to ensure a smooth recovery and optimal results.

    Final Results and Follow-Up

    While you may notice immediate improvements, the final results of chin liposuction become more evident as the swelling subsides. This can take several weeks to a few months. Regular follow-up appointments with your surgeon are important to monitor your progress and address any concerns.

    Understanding the Recovery Period for Chin Liposuction in Toronto

    Chin liposuction is a popular procedure designed to enhance the contour of the chin and jawline by removing excess fat. If you're considering this procedure in Toronto, it's natural to wonder about the recovery timeline. Here’s a detailed look at what you can expect.

    Initial Recovery Phase

    Immediately following the procedure, you may experience some swelling, bruising, and discomfort. This is normal and typically lasts for about a week. During this period, it's important to follow your surgeon's post-operative instructions carefully. This includes wearing any compression garments as advised, which help to minimize swelling and support the healing process.

    Intermediate Recovery Phase

    By the end of the first week, most patients feel well enough to return to their daily activities, although strenuous exercise should be avoided for at least two weeks. The swelling will gradually subside, and you may start to see the initial results of the procedure. However, it's important to note that the final results will not be fully visible until several months after the surgery.

    Long-Term Recovery and Results

    Over the next few months, the remaining swelling will continue to diminish, and the skin will tighten around the treated area. By the three-month mark, most patients are quite pleased with the results. The full effects of chin liposuction are usually evident by six months post-procedure. It's important to maintain a healthy lifestyle to ensure the longevity of your results, including a balanced diet and regular exercise.

    Consultation and Preparation

    Before undergoing chin liposuction, it's crucial to have a thorough consultation with a qualified plastic surgeon. During this consultation, your surgeon will assess your medical history, discuss your expectations, and provide a realistic overview of the procedure and recovery process. Proper preparation, including quitting smoking and avoiding certain medications, can significantly improve your recovery experience.
